Shrine Search - Auditions Closed

​As a part of our Young Artists' Initiative, Media Context will work with its partners to create an animated pilot from one of our students' original ideas:
Picture

Synopsis

In order to join a guild of adventurers, a group of cadets must recover artefacts from a series of dangerous shrines.

​For as long as he can remember, Zephyr Goldfinger dreamed of being a great adventurer. He gets his chance once he is scouted by the Shrinehelm Explorers, the greatest guild of adventurers in his kingdom.

​Before Zeph can join them as a permanent member, he has to train with them as a cadet. He must embark on Shrine Searches, quests that lead him into ancient structures, where he’ll recover the treasures that they contain.

​Although this is Zeph’s first big step towards his dream, achieving his goal is harder than he thinks.
​
Joined by the barbarian warrior Myra, the dwarven sharpshooter Dorian, and the elven healer Galen, Zeph must journey into territories that are more dangerous than he expected, and recover artefacts that are deadlier than he imagined.

Character List
​

Galen
​

Picture
Gender: Male
Age: 16-18
Accent: Standard American
Galen, an elven magician from the Southern Islands, is skilled with healing magic.

Unlike his fellow Nightshade elves, who typically practice destructive magic, Galen has developed the power to heal. He leaves his clan to join the Shrinehelm cadets, where he believes his powers would be appreciated.
​
Timid and risk-adverse, Galen hates how his party blindly charges into dangerous situations. Given that he is soft-spoken and gentle, he rarely expresses his disapproval to his rowdy teammates. Nonetheless, he is loyal enough to rush to their rescue.

Myra
​

Picture
Gender: Female
Age: 25-30
Accent: Standard American
Myra Kyii, a barbarian warrior from the Eastern Empire, is an expert combatant.

Armed with a battleaxe that can transform into any close-range weapon, Myra is a formidable force on the battlefield. Ferocious and stalwart, she decides to train with the Shrinehelmers as a cadet, even if her clan believes that her menial rank insults her abilities.
​
Although Myra is a skilled fighter, her social skills aren’t very strong. She tends to intimidate those she interacts with and finds it difficult to bond with her team.

Dorian
​

Picture
​Gender: Male
Age: 40-50
Accent: Standard American
Dorian Shellfire, a dwarven sharpshooter from the Western Domain, can hit any target with deadly accuracy.

Dorian, an experienced circus performer, dazzled crowds by firing a musket that shot magical bullets. His illustrious career came to a halt after his troupe dismissed him for threatening a patron. Having nowhere else to go, Dorian agreed to train with the Shrinehelmers.
​
Witty, fearless and brash, Dorian charges into any battle with guns blazing. However, given that his temper often gets the best of him, his teammates often find themselves in his crossfire.

Selena
​

Picture
​Gender: Female
Age: 15-16
Accent: Standard American
Selena, an aspiring strategist, is a cadet who is in her final year of training.

Intelligent and resourceful, Selena can retrieve arcane information from the Shrinehelmers' archives, which proves to be useful during her friends' adventures. Instead of joining them on the field, she prefers to remain in the Shrinehelmers' Headquarters, and uses a Communication Pendant to speak with her team.

Although Selena is a capable cadet, she tends to doubt her abilities. Fearing backlash from her superiors, or envy from her fellow cadets, she shies away from opportunities to show her true potential.
